ACCESS PATH. require_supported_pdp_address refuses in-cluster Service names
and any non-loopback host. This is no longer a unilateral call: the owner
path is documented as loopback kubectl port-forward over the authenticated
Kubernetes API, which is what authenticates the responder transitively
(FLEX-DEC-2026-010). A Service name from a workstation does not fail, it
resolves through the DNS search suffix to an unrelated public host, and
since decision records carry no signature, a responder knowing the
published package and version can return an allow that passes every check
we make. Fail-closed protects against a PDP that is absent, not one that
lies. The guard runs before the token is read, so a misdirected request
cannot leak it; a test pins that ordering.

THE DEFECT IT FOUND. The evaluator enriches from its registry before
hashing -- subject gains attributes and tenant, resource gains tenant --
so binding.request_digest is over material we never sent and cannot
reproduce. validate_decision_envelope rejects every real allow.

Every replay test passes because _request_from() rebuilds the request out
of the binding, i.e. the enriched form: a self-consistent fake agreeing
with itself, which hid this through three rounds of digest work. Third
time a real artifact has beaten a fake in this integration.

NOT FIXED, DELIBERATELY. Rejecting a valid allow is wrong in the safe
direction. Which fields may be enriched is flex-auth's contract to publish;
inferring it means accepting a binding that differs from our proposal in a
way we decided was benign -- the fail-open shape GH-DEC-2026-008 rejected
for vocabularies and FLEX-DEC-2026-007 for digests. Raised with them.

secrets-engine

Headless, multi-application, multi-tenant secrets workflow and automation layer for approved secret custody, delivery, and lifecycle work across build, test, and production stages.

Layer: Engine / Lifecycle under the accepted NetKingdom Security Layer Model (layer.yaml). OpenBao remains the custody and enforcement backend. secrets-engine is the deterministic API over it: catalog, decision consumption, plan/apply, guarded provisioning, verification, delivery, evidence, lifecycle metadata, and native-access deactivation. It does not render authorization decisions. Local evidence can be inspected through an allowlisted per-lane audit summary without exposing record detail.

Start Here

Core Direction

The MVP proves the whynot-design-npm-publish lane end to end:

  1. describe the lane in a non-secret catalog (catalog/);
  2. verify an approved decision (State Hub or local fixture);
  3. apply OpenBao policy/auth metadata through a stage-aware role;
  4. provision and verify the value without printing it;
  5. run a workload command through safe exec-time delivery.

Target command shape:

secrets-engine exec --catalog whynot-design-npm-publish -- npm publish

Quickstart

uv venv && uv pip install -e ".[dev]"
source .venv/bin/activate
secrets-engine catalog list

# Run the whole pilot chain live against a throwaway OpenBao dev server:
SECRETS_ENGINE_HUB_URL="" bash scripts/demo-e2e.sh

The implementation is a Python package (src/secrets_engine/). OpenBao is reached only through the bao CLI adapter (openbao.py); the rest of the code speaks in lanes and guarded plans.

Security Rules

  • Do not put raw secret values in Git, State Hub, chat, prompts, issue comments, workplans, or normal logs.
  • OpenBao is the backend custody and audit authority.
  • Build, test, and production have separate policy boundaries.
  • Production live actions fail closed until the durable State Hub action-authorization endpoint is available; local approval mirrors are throwaway-demo material only.
  • A privileged production OpenBao call also requires a successful approval-engine CAS consume first. Conflict or unavailability means do not write.
  • Temporary bootstrap OpenBao credentials must live outside repos, use mode 0600, be revocable, and be removed after narrower auth is working.
